>>> You rowkey schema is not efficient, it  will result in region hot
>>> spotting (unless you salt your table).
>>> DATA_BLOCK_ENCODING is beneficial for both  in memory and on disk
>>> storage. Compression is must as well.
>>> It is hard to say how block encoding + compression will affect query
>>> performance in your case, but common sense
>>> tell us that the more data you keep in memory block cache - the better
>>> overall performance you have. Block encoding
>>> in your case is  a MUST, as for compression - ymmv but  usually snappy,
>>> lzo or lz4 improves performance as well.
>>> Block cache in 0.94-8 does not support compression but supports block
>>> encoding.
